Choosing Local UPVC Window Installers: Your Guide to Quality and Affordability
When it comes to home enhancement, one financial investment that homeowners often neglect is the installation of UPVC (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) windows. These windows offer a plethora of advantages, including energy effectiveness, low upkeep, and sound insulation. Nevertheless, to completely reap these benefits, it's crucial to hire local UPVC window installers who are both reliable and experienced. This article will check out everything you require to understand about local UPVC window installers, from why local matters to how to pick the ideal one.
Why Choose Local UPVC Window Installers?
Local UPVC window installers bring an unique set of benefits that nationwide brands might not provide. Here are some crucial factors to consider working with a local business:
| Advantages of Choosing Local Installers | Description |
|---|---|
| Neighborhood Knowledge | Local installers understand the specific building designs and regulations of your area. |
| Availability | Neighboring means quicker response times for quotes, concerns, and service. |
| Personalized Service | Local installers are most likely to use personalized solutions tailored to individual needs. |
| Support Local Economy | Hiring local fosters neighborhood growth and produces jobs within the area. |
| Trust and Reputation | Local services are typically built on credibility; they might offer testimonials from previous customers in your area. |
Elements to Consider When Choosing Local UPVC Window Installers
Selecting the ideal UPVC window installer can feel overwhelming due to the variety of options offered. Here's an extensive list of factors you should think about to guarantee you make a notified decision:
Experience and Qualifications
- Search for installers with substantial experience in the industry.
- Look for certifications and certifications that affirm their expertise.
Portfolio of Work
- Examine their previous installation tasks, which will provide insight into their abilities.
- Request before-and-after pictures of comparable work.
Recommendations and Reviews
- Seek reviews online or ask for references from past consumers.
- Platforms like Google Reviews, Yelp, and Facebook can use valuable insights.
Guarantee and Aftercare Services
- Make sure the installer supplies a warranty on both materials and workmanship.
- Inquire about their aftercare and maintenance services.
Price Quotation
- Demand numerous quotes to understand the market rate.
- Watch out for prices that seem too low, as they might recommend lower-quality products or craftsmanship.
Compliance with Regulations

- Confirm that the installer abides by local structure codes and policies.
- Ask if they are registered with any industry bodies.
Insurance Coverage and Safety Practices
- Confirm that the installer has the necessary insurance coverage.
- Ask about their safety practices to safeguard both employees and your home.
The Benefits of UPVC Windows
Before diving into the installation process, it's worth recapping the numerous advantages that UPVC windows offer:
| Benefits of UPVC Windows | Description |
|---|---|
| Energy Efficiency | UPVC windows use exceptional insulation, assisting to keep your home warm in winter and cool in summertime. |
| Low Maintenance | Unlike wood, UPVC does not need frequent painting or staining and is resistant to rot and deterioration. |
| Durability | UPVC windows can last as much as 20 years or more, depending upon upkeep. |
| Cost-Effectiveness | While the initial investment may be higher, UPVC windows can minimize energy bills in time. |
| Noise Reduction | Their insulating homes assist decrease noise from outdoors, making your home quieter. |
The Installation Process
Comprehending the installation process ahead of time can help set expectations. Here's a quick overview of what usually takes place when local UPVC window installers handle a project:
Consultation
-- The installer visits your home to examine your requirements and take measurements.-- Discuss your choices, consisting of styles and colors.Estimating the Job
-- Based on the assessment, the installer provides a comprehensive quote, consisting of a breakdown of products and labor expenses.Buying the Windows
-- Once the quote is accepted, the windows are ordered usually tailored to your requirements.Installation Day
-- On the agreed date, the installation team shows up, generally requiring a few hours to complete the task.-- Old windows will be eliminated, and new UPVC windows will be fitted and sealed.Last Inspection and Cleanup
-- After installation, the team will examine that everything is properly set up and working.-- They will tidy up the area, leaving it as they found it.
